BRUNSWICK CORPORATION | Professional Services | 16608 | $6.4B | United States | Diligent Corporation | Diligent HighBond | Governance, Risk and Compliance | 2018 | n/a | In 2018, Brunswick Corporation implemented Diligent HighBond in the Governance, Risk and Compliance category to centralize audit and risk functions. The rollout aligned the application with the internal audit organization and risk management teams to establish a single platform for audit planning and control testing. The Diligent HighBond implementation emphasized audit management, risk assessment, controls testing, and compliance reporting capabilities typical of Governance, Risk and Compliance platforms. Configuration work included standardized audit program templates, issue tracking and remediation workflows, automated evidence collection and configurable dashboards for executive and audit committee reporting. Ongoing training of Audit Command Language using HighBond GRC is part of the operational adoption, indicating use of analytics and data interrogation within audit workflows. Governance and process changes focused on centralizing audit procedures, instituting role based access controls and embedding HighBond driven workflows into the internal audit function. | |

Builders FirstSource | Distribution | 29000 | $17.1B | United States | Diligent Corporation | Diligent HighBond | Governance, Risk and Compliance | 2018 | n/a | In 2018, Builders FirstSource implemented Diligent HighBond to support Governance, Risk and Compliance across its audit, risk and compliance functions. The deployment concentrated on centralizing risk and audit activity tracking and establishing a single reporting fabric for compliance evidence and control testing, using Diligent HighBond as the primary GRC application. The implementation configured Diligent HighBond with data aggregation, analytics, automated workflow orchestration and dashboard reporting capabilities typical of Governance, Risk and Compliance solutions. Builders FirstSource also pursued process automation through the ACL Robotics program, instrumenting routine data ingestion and control testing tasks to reduce manual handling and accelerate reporting cycles. Operational use covered internal audit, enterprise risk and compliance teams, with supporting analytics workflows leveraging familiar tools such as SAS and SQL for deeper data interrogation and query-based evidence collection. The environment emphasized near real-time aggregation of control and exception data to enable more timely decision making and consolidated reporting within Diligent HighBond. Governance measures were instituted to standardize templates, evidence capture and approval workflows, shifting review and remediation coordination onto the Diligent HighBond platform. Rollout was organized around function-based adoption and automation milestones, with ongoing expansion of ACL Robotics automation to further operationalize repeatable GRC processes. | |
